Marjorie was born on June 29, 192,3 in Annawan, IL, the daughter of Henry and Augusta (Mariman) DeGerengel. She was united in marriage to Marvin F. VanHyfte. Marvin preceded her in death in 1992. Marjorie was a sales associate for 28 years at Four Seasons in downtown Geneseo. She, and her husband, Marvin, farmed in rural Annawan for many years and she was proud to still be living on the family farm. She also worked for many years at Guild’s Drug Store in Annawan, IL.
Marjorie was a member of Sacred Heart Catholic Church of Annawan as well as the Altar and Rosary Society. She taught CCD classes at Sacred Heart. She enjoyed her violets, doing housekeeping, her clock collection, raising her children, and spending time with her grandchildren. Recently she also enjoyed traveling.
